#15f54e h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#15f54e is composed of 8.2% red, 96.1%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.2%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 135.3 degrees, a saturation of 91.8% and a lightness of 52.2%. #15f54e color hex could be obtained by blending #2aff9c with #00eb00. Closest websafe color is: #00ff66.

● #15f54e color description : Vivid cyan - lime green.
The hexadecimal color #15f54e has RGB values of R:21, G:245, B:78 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0, Y:0.68,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 1439054.
